Information Systems

Information systems (IS) are combinations of hardware, software, data, people, and processes that work together to collect, store, process, and transmit information. They are designed to support the information needs of an organization. Key Characteristics / Core Concepts Hardware: The physical components like computers, servers, and network devices. Health Informatics

Health informatics is the interdisciplinary field that studies and uses information systems to improve healthcare services. It focuses on the effective use of electronic information and communication technologies to optimize healthcare processes. Key Characteristics / Core Concepts Data Management: Efficiently collecting, storing, retrieving, and analyzing patient data.
